Warning Signs You Need Behind Wall Water Damage Restoration

Catching the signs of behind-wall water damage early is vital. Ignoring these subtle clues can lead to much more expensive repairs down the line, including structural issues and significant mold problems. Pay attention to what your home is telling you. Recognizing these indicators can save you considerable time and money.

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

A persistent, damp, or musty smell that you can’t trace to an obvious source, like a spilled drink or a leaky faucet, is a strong indicator of hidden moisture. This odor often originates from dampness within walls or under floors. It’s your home’s way of signaling a problem that needs immediate attention.

Discolored Walls or Ceilings

Look for new stains, dark spots, or peeling paint on your walls or ceilings. These often appear as yellow or brown splotches. They are direct visual evidence that water is seeping through the drywall from behind. This is a clear sign of an active leak or past water intrusion.

Warped or Sagging Walls

As drywall absorbs water, it can lose its structural integrity. This can cause sections of the wall to bulge outward, sag, or appear uneven. This is a more serious sign that the materials within your wall are becoming saturated and weakening. It requires prompt professional intervention.

Mold or Mildew Growth

Visible mold or mildew on walls, especially in areas where you wouldn’t expect moisture, is a major red flag. Mold thrives in dark, damp environments like the hidden spaces within your walls. Its presence indicates a long-term moisture issue that needs to be addressed at the source.

Increased Humidity Levels

If your home suddenly feels more humid than usual, even when the weather isn’t particularly damp, there might be a hidden water source. Unseen leaks can release moisture into the air, raising indoor humidity. This can make your home feel uncomfortable and contribute to mold growth.

Unexplained High Water Bills

A sudden, significant increase in your water bill, without a corresponding change in your usage habits, could point to a hidden leak. Water seeping into your walls or plumbing systems can lead to considerable waste. This financial indicator often accompanies other physical signs of damage.

Behind Wall Water Damage Restoration v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Minor surface drip from a pipe fitting Yes, if you’re comfortable with basic plumbing. Maybe, if it’s hard to reach or you suspect it’s ongoing. Small leaks can indicate a larger issue needing expert diagnosis.
Visible mold growth on drywall surface No. Yes, always. Mold behind walls requires specialized containment and remediation.
Wall feels damp to the touch, but no visible stain No. Yes, absolutely. Hidden moisture needs specialized drying equipment to prevent rot.
Small, isolated water stain on ceiling Maybe, if it’s very small and dry. Yes, if it’s large or recurring. Stains can indicate a leak that needs to be stopped at the source.
Musty odor with no obvious cause No. Yes, definitely. Odors are a strong sign of hidden mold or rot in wall cavities.
Warped or sagging drywall No. Yes, immediately. Structural damage requires professional assessment and repair.

For anything beyond a very minor, easily accessible issue, calling a professional is the safest bet. Behind-wall damage requires specialized knowledge and equipment that most homeowners don’t have. Behind Wall Water Damage Restoration Cost In Rogers, MN

The cost of behind-wall water damage restoration in Rogers, MN, can vary significantly. Factors like the extent of the damage, the size of the affected area, and the complexity of the repairs all play a role. These figures are general estimates and a detailed on-site assessment is needed for an accurate quote. We aim for transparent pricing throughout the restoration process.

Service Aspect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Initial Inspection & Assessment $300 – $800 Use of advanced equipment like thermal cameras and moisture meters.
Water Extraction (behind walls) $500 – $2,500 Amount of water to remove and number of access points needed.
Drying and Dehumidification $1,000 – $4,000+ Duration needed to dry materials, number of dehumidifiers/air movers used.
Mold Prevention/Remediation $750 – $3,000+ Severity of mold growth and area requiring treatment.
Drywall Repair & Patching $400 – $1,500 Size of the area needing repair and complexity of the patch.
Painting & Finishing $300 – $1,000+ Square footage of the area to be painted and matching existing textures.

These costs often get covered by homeowners insurance policies for sudden and accidental water damage. We can help you navigate the claims process. Getting a free estimate is the best way to understand the specific costs for your situation.

Common Questions About Behind Wall Water Damage Restoration

How quickly do I need to address water damage behind my walls?

You need to act as soon as possible. Within 24-48 hours, mold can begin to grow in damp wall cavities, and structural materials can start to degrade. The longer you wait, the more extensive and costly the damage becomes. Our team is available to respond quickly, minimizing the impact on your home and health.

Will my homeowner’s insurance cover behind-wall water damage?

Generally, yes, if the damage was caused by a sudden and accidental event, like a burst pipe or appliance malfunction. Damage from slow leaks or poor maintenance might be excluded. We work closely with your insurance provider, documenting the damage thoroughly to help you maximize your claim. We understand the insurance claim process.

How do you dry out walls without making a huge mess?

We use specialized tools and techniques to minimize disruption. Instead of tearing down large sections of drywall, we carefully create small, strategic access points to insert drying equipment like air movers and moisture probes directly into the wall cavity. Our goal is to perform efficient, targeted drying while keeping the demolition and mess to a minimum.

What are the health risks associated with hidden water damage?

The primary health risk is mold growth. Mold spores can cause allergic reactions, respiratory problems, and other health issues, especially for those with pre-existing conditions. Dampness can also attract insects and rodents. We prioritize your family’s safety by ensuring all moisture is removed and any mold is properly remediated, creating a healthy indoor environment.

How long does the behind-wall water damage restoration process typically take?

The timeline varies greatly depending on the severity of the water intrusion and the size of the affected area. The drying process alone can take anywhere from three days to two weeks. Reconstruction can add several more days or weeks.
